Frequently Asked Questions about North Canton
How much are Studio apartments in North Canton?
There are currently 7 Studio Apartments in North Canton with rent ranges from $650 to $770 with an average price of $701.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om North Canton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in North Canton ranges from $700 to $1,500 with an average monthly rent of $1,011.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in North Canton c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in North Canton range from $800 to $3,102.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,562.
How expensive are North Canton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 17 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in North Canton on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$950 to $3,245 - averaging $1,733 for the location.
